Comrade Dauda Engages Computer Village Plaza Heads On Revenue, Security & Development

ADEOLA OGUNLADE 

The Executive Chairman of Ikeja Local Government, Comrade Akeem Olalekan Dauda (AKOD), has engaged plaza heads and business operators in Computer Village on revenue generation, security, sanitation and improved service delivery.

 

Speaking at a stakeholders’ meeting held at the council on Tuesday, Comrade Dauda explained that revenue paid by businesses is public money, not personal funds, and assured stakeholders that the council is committed to using it responsibly for the benefit of residents and businesses.

He said Computer Village, as a major corporate business hub, requires a revenue system that reflects its unique nature, while promising continued engagement to ensure fairness and accurate classification of shops and businesses.

 

Comrade Dauda disclosed that the council is also working to channel resources into key areas including security, environmental sanitation, roads, healthcare and other community services.

On security, he urged plaza owners and traders to see it as a collective responsibility, stressing that insecurity affects businesses by discouraging customers and reducing economic activities.

He also called for updated records of current occupants and businesses in the plazas to improve revenue assessment and eliminate outdated information.

“It is not personal money. It is the money that all of us will benefit from at the end of the day.” — Comrade Dauda.

 

The Council Chairman assured Computer Village stakeholders that the administration would continue to listen to their concerns and work with them as partners in progress to restore the area’s old glory.
